The realms noted above are setup in a hierarchical structure where the resources in the parent realms are available but the <<realm is searched first before a search is made in the parent realm>>. Plugins are guaranteed to be provided the resources found in <<<plexus.core>>> and <<<plexus.core.maven>>> realms at run-time if required.
